Saving Ryan’s private actor Tom Sizemore in critical condition after suffering a brain aneurysm | Entz & Arts News

Actor Tom Sizemore is critically ill with a brain aneurysm.

The 61-year-old suffered an aneurysm while at home in Los Angeles around 2 a.m. Saturday, said his manager Charles Lago.

The actor is in intensive care at the hospital, with Lago describing the situation as a “wait and see”.

Sizemore is best known for his roles as Sergeant on Tom Hanks’ side in the 1998 World War II epic Saving Private Ryan and as commander of an Army Ranger Battalion in the 2001 film Black Hawk Down. It is

He also appeared in the 1995 crime drama Heat, and his role in Witness Protection earned him a Golden Globe nomination in 2000 for Best Actor in a Miniseries or Film Made for Television.

Sizemore struggled with drug addiction during her acting career and was arrested multiple times for driving under the influence and drug possession.

In 2003, he was convicted of domestic violence against his girlfriend, Heidi Fleiss, and three years later did not contest using methamphetamine outside a motel.

He was arrested in 2009 and 2011 on charges of assaulting his former spouse.
